Market Sizing, Growth Estimates, and CAGR Projections

Based on a comprehensive assessment of healthcare expenditure, aging population trends, and technological adoption rates, the South Korea enteral nutrition pumps market was valued at approximately USD 150 million in 2023. The market is projected to grow at a compound annual growth rate (CAGR) of 7.5% over the next five years, reaching an estimated USD 230 million by 2028.

Assumptions underpinning these estimates include:

  • Annual healthcare expenditure growth of 4% driven by government policies and private sector investments.
  • Increasing prevalence of chronic diseases and malnutrition among the elderly population, contributing to higher demand for enteral feeding solutions.
  • Rapid technological adoption, including smart pumps with IoT capabilities, which command premium pricing and higher adoption rates.

Market Ecosystem and Operational Framework

Key Product Categories

  • Standard Enteral Nutrition Pumps: Basic models suitable for hospital use, offering manual control and limited features.
  • Smart Enteral Nutrition Pumps: Equipped with digital interfaces, programmable settings, and connectivity features for remote monitoring.
  • Portable/Transportable Pumps: Compact devices designed for home care and outpatient settings.

Demand-Supply Framework

The demand is primarily driven by healthcare institutions and home-care providers, with supply chains anchored in local manufacturing and imports. The supply chain involves raw material sourcing (plastics, electronics, sensors), manufacturing (assembly, quality control), distribution (wholesale, direct sales), and end-user delivery (hospital procurement, home-care agencies). Lifecycle services include maintenance, calibration, and software updates, generating recurring revenue streams.

Value Chain and Revenue Models

The value chain encompasses:

  1. Raw Material Sourcing: Suppliers of medical-grade plastics, electronic components, and sensors.
  2. Manufacturing & Assembly: OEMs and contract manufacturers focusing on quality assurance and regulatory compliance.
  3. Distribution & Logistics: Regional distributors, direct sales teams, and e-commerce platforms.
  4. End-User Application: Hospitals, clinics, and home-care providers integrating pumps into treatment protocols.

Revenue models include device sales, consumables (e.g., tubing, connectors), software licensing, and after-sales services. Lifecycle management and remote monitoring subscriptions are increasingly significant revenue streams, especially for smart pump systems.

Digital Transformation and Interoperability

The market is witnessing a paradigm shift towards digital health integration. Key trends include:

  • Adoption of IoT-enabled pumps that facilitate remote data collection and analytics.
  • Standardization of interoperability protocols (e.g., HL7, IEEE 11073) to enable seamless integration with hospital information systems (HIS) and electronic health records (EHRs).
  • Cross-industry collaborations with telehealth platforms, AI analytics providers, and device manufacturers to enhance functionality.

This digital evolution improves clinical outcomes, reduces errors, and optimizes resource utilization, aligning with value-based care models.

Adoption Trends and End-User Insights

Hospital settings dominate initial adoption, driven by clinical efficacy and reimbursement policies. However, the home-care segment is rapidly expanding, supported by technological innovations and patient preference for comfort.

Real-world use cases include:

  • Post-stroke patients requiring long-term enteral feeding at home, managed via portable smart pumps with remote monitoring.
  • Oncology patients undergoing chemotherapy, benefiting from integrated nutrition systems that minimize infection risks.
  • Geriatric care facilities adopting automated pumps to streamline nutritional support and reduce caregiver burden.

Shifting consumption patterns favor portable, user-friendly devices with connectivity features, reflecting a move towards personalized and decentralized care.
